A cost-ranked curve alone can send the wrong signal - it will happily rank a cheap credit above an expensive process redesign. This tool keeps the mitigation hierarchy in view: what's measured, what's avoided, reduced and substituted first, where sector and market instruments fit, and where removals are gated to genuine unavoidable residual only.
Illustrative planning tool, not a compliance model. Target-line shape is a simplified two-segment linear
approximation of an SBTi 1.5°C trajectory; real target validation requires the SBTi tools and sector-specific
guidance. Removal levers are capped programmatically each year to the residual remaining after all other tiers -
they cannot be used to substitute for available reduction, and excess removal capacity beyond the residual is
never double-counted. Lever costs, potentials and timings live in the LEVERS array in the script and
should be replaced with your own data before this is used for real decisions.
